Role Purpose
Ensuring the compliance of materials and components supplied by third parties by efficiently managing complaints from production/incoming/workshops, implementing corrective and preventive actions, monitoring supplier performance, and collaborating with internal departments to support continuous quality improvement.
M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ES:
1. Supplier complaint management
• Immediate recording of supplier-related nonconformities – analysis of complaints from production/warehouse/workshops.
• Internal communication to the relevant parties (production, procurement, internal quality).
• Physical isolation of nonconforming materials, proper labeling, and system blocking.
• Formal initiation of the complaint to the supplier: documentation, photos, codes, quantities, unmet specifications.
• Monitoring the implementation of immediate and long-term actions by the supplier.
• Verification of the effectiveness of the actions (measurement, analysis, reports) and closure of the complaint.
